games are files that have been run through archiving software like 7Zip or WinRAR. In some cases, advanced tools can strip dummy data (padding data developers used to push data to the outer edge of the disc for faster reading).

"Highly compressed" or "fixed" PS1 games are ISO or BIN/CUE files that have been re-encoded, often converted into formats like or CHD (Compressed Hunk of Data) . Why "Fixed"?

These files save space by removing "unnecessary" data like background music (BGM) and cinematic cutscenes (FMVs). While small, they often feel "empty."

If a game's code called for an FMV cutscene that had been completely deleted, the emulator would crash, making the game unplayable past a certain level.
